Abstract

Co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) is the present global public health problem that has already caused pandemic since 2020. This respiratory corona viral infection can cause severe respiratory illness and death might be the outcome in severe cases. COVID-19 can manifest several atypical clinical presentations including neurological presentation. An important neurological problem is neurovascular thrombotic disorder A thrombotic event might be due to arterial or venous system affection. The study was conducted in the public laboratories on the outskirts of Baghdad after collecting 100 samples, (60) of people infected with Covid - 19 and (40) of healthy people and the ages of the people ranged from 18-80 years and the ages of the healthy ones from 18-70 years old. The study was conducted to investigate some biochemical indicators which includes Chemokine CXCL10, Fibrinogen, D-dimer, ferritin, C-reactive protein, iron and fibrinogen. The results showed a significant increase in the level of the chemokine CXCL10 in patients infected with Covid-19 virus compared to the control group, and a significant increase in the levels of D-dimer, ferritin, C-reactive protein, iron and fibrinogen which are important biochemical indicators in Covid – 19 patients.
